Abstract
This study aims to design and develop a game-based English interactive learning environment using video-capture virtual reality technology. The system is designed for English teaching course in elementary school by physical body interaction. Two detection methods are used in the system, one is RGB color values detection, the other is gestures detection. There are six stages of learning activities are designed by integrating into English curriculum with specific tasks and learning objectives. In addition to operate the system by physical movement, students can also use various properties, such as pistol, x-ray searchlight, magnet, spray paint can, and conical cap. This is designed to improve the accuracy of detection, as well as to increase the fun during the learning process. The system also provides an interface for teachers to edit the teaching materials when they have different requirement for teaching. A preliminary study was conducted at an elementary school of 30 second grade class students. The data collected from the pre- and post- tests. The result shows that there are significant differences between the pre-test and the post-test (p=.031<;.05).
